Keep Calm and Carry On!
Do you occasionally struggle with anger? We live in a broken world where sin is rampant, injustice is commonplace, and anger rages around us. This growing trend can also cause us to stumble into sin. Although we often cannot change the situations around us, altering our responses is possible. When hurt by someone's words or actions, we may be tempted to hurl a sarcastic reply or harbor resentment. As followers of Jesus, we are called to model his life: "When he was reviled, he did not revile in return; when he suffered, he did not threaten but continued entrusting himself to him who judges justly (1 Peter 2:23)."
Today's Proverb emphasizes the value of being slow to anger. This is especially important when facing verbal attacks. Quiet listening protects us from speaking rashly and offers us the opportunity to seek God's wisdom and grace. A calm, gentle reply can defuse most tense situations. We can only respond wisely if we take time to process what was said. When we are slow to anger, we can often gain an understanding of the situation and the hidden motives that a quick-tempered person can't objectively comprehend. As believers, our character must mirror Jesus. Preserving civility must, at times, replace our need to be correct. So, pause, Keep Calm, and Carry On; all things are possible with Jesus as our counselor and defender.
